Professional Documents
Culture Documents
Agenda
o o o o o o o o o What is commissioning. Role of include & exclude file. Entry for include & exclude file How to commission a new node. What is decommissioning. How to decommission an old node. What is ACL Why do we need ACL. Role of hadoop-policy.xml
What is commissioning
o Hadoop is scalable. o We can increase/decrease number of nodes in a Hadoop cluster. o Adding a new machine (node) to Hadoop cluster is known as commissioning. o Commissioning a new node will increase the storage as well as processing of Hadoop cluster.
What is decommissioning
o We can remove any node from Hadoop cluster, if required. o We can't directly shut down the node. o The data should be copied to other nodes, before this node leaves cluster. o Removing an old machine (node) from Hadoop cluster is known as decommissioning o Decommissioning a node from cluster, may decrease cluster performance.
What is ACL
ACL is access control list. ACL contains security related information. ACL contains list of authorized users, who can perform specific activity on Hadoop cluster. Hadoop doesn't allow the users to perform activity who are not part of ACL. Hadoop Admin manage ACL.
Hadoop-policy.xml
hadoop-policy.xml file in HADOOP_HOME/conf directory contains all security related setting.
<property> <name>security.job.submission.protocol.acl</name> <value>*</value> <description>ACL for JobSubmissionProtocol, used by job clients to communciate with the jobtracker for job submission, querying job status etc. The ACL is a comma-separated list of user and group names. The user and group list is separated by a blank. For e.g. "alice,bob users,wheel". A special value of "*" means all users are allowed. </description> </property>
Thanks